Mao now does a triple axel with difficult/creative exit, has transitions going into her triple flip which finally got the flow on the landing and does a nice set-up into the loop with that hop. Choreography is wonderful, detailed, sublime. Elegant and yet powerful flow between the elements. The only thing that should be improved is the speed in her spins. Looks like Mao is going for the gold in Sochi. I think she's never been in such form at the very beginning of the season, hasn't she?

I have to hand it to Asada . . . she has done a complete 180 turn from where she was at the beginning of this Olympic cycle when she first moved to Nobuo Sato and she was skating disastrous program after disastrous program and basically pulling herself off everyone's radars as an Olympic contender. It really wasn't until the 2013 Worlds LP that she began to find her mojo again. Great, solid start to her Olympic season! She has shown that she is a fighter! Her tenacity and determination is paying off! :)
